Web26 mei 2024 · George Romero began to play with the concept of a "smart zombie" in 1985's Day of the Dead, which saw the former soldier turned zombie Bub slowly learning to be human again. Romero picked up that concept with 2005's Land of the Dead where the zombies, led by Big Daddy, begin to use tools to get to that tasty human flesh. Web27 mrt. 2024 · The person who has died is washed as quickly as possible after death and wrapped in a simple white shroud. For men, up to three pieces of cloth may be used for this purpose, for women, five. In many countries, a coffin is not used, but in the UK, where this is often forbidden, a coffin is permitted. The body is positioned facing towards Mecca.
